Dual Gradient Density or also known as DGD water filters cartridges are a type of filter cartridge specifically designed to improve the efficiency and longevity of water filtration and filter systems. these cartridges utilize a dual gradient density structure, which means that the filter medias density changes across the length of the cartridge, which offers enhanced particle capturing capabilities from larger pore sizes on the outer layer to a smaller finer pore size on the inner layer. This is turn extends the life span of the filter and other filters to follow, capturing a wide range of particle sizes effectively trapping them in the outer layer and inner layer, allowing for a more thorough and consistent performance in filtration without disrupting the flow rate. Having a wide range of uses in many different settings, and various micron ratings makes it a great pre filter for a point of use or point of entry system.
